What is the auspicious time to tie Rakhi on Rakshabandhan? Know the time and Rahul Kaal also

This year the festival of Rakshabandhan will be celebrated on 28th August. In Hindu religion, Rakshabandhan is not considered just a festival, but it is considered a symbol of affection and unbreakable bond between brother and sister. In this festival all the sisters tie Rakhi to their brothers. Many religious experts believe that sisters should tie Rakhi at the right time. Otherwise, tying Rakhi at the wrong time is considered inauspicious. For this reason, you should also know the right time to tie Rakhi.

 

This year the festival of Rakshabandhan will be celebrated on 28th of the month of Sawan. This day will be Friday. While on one hand Rakhi will be tied to all the elder or younger brothers on this day, on the other hand brothers will give gifts to their sisters. Now the question arises that what is the auspicious time to tie Rakhi.

What is the auspicious time?

According to religious experts, there are 5 auspicious times on the day of Rakshabandhan, during which a person should tie Rakhi. Apart from this, a person should avoid tying Rakhi during Rahukaal. Tying Rakhi during Rahukaal can lead to differences between brothers and sisters. Let us know what are the auspicious times of Rakshabandhan?

 

1.Amrit Choghadiya– It will last from 6:08 am to 10:53 am.
2.Abhijeet Choghadiya- It will last from 12:04 pm to 12:53 pm.
3. Auspicious Choghadiya- It will last from 12:28 pm to 2:03 pm.
4. Afternoon time- It will be from 1:44 pm to 4:16 pm.
5.Char Choghadiya- It will last from 5:13 pm to 6:48 pm.

When should Rakhi not be tied?

Religious experts of Hindu religion believe that sisters should avoid tying Rakhi during Rahukaal. According to the Panchang, on the day of Rakshabandhan, Rahukaal will be from 10.54 am to 12.28 am. Do not tie Rakhi during this time because Rahukaal is considered inauspicious.

 

According to religious experts, tying Rakhi during Rahukaal has a negative impact on the brother's life, which can increase the challenges in the brother's life. Also, difficult times may begin in life. For this reason, one should avoid tying Rakhi during Rahukaal.
